Linux에 Control Room 설치

Linux 환경에서 Automation Anywhere Control Room 설치를 시작하고 Control Room에서 설치를 완료합니다.

이 태스크는 최초 설치 및 Automation 360 온프레미스 업데이트에 적용됩니다.

주: 설치 단계에는 특정 구성이나 요구 사항이 나열되지 않으므로 설치가 다를 수 있습니다. Automation Anywhere은(는) 설치 단계가 시스템 구성이나 요구 사항을 준수한다는 어떠한 보증도 제공하지 않습니다.

다음 정보를 명심하십시오.

  • Control RoomOracle Database을 설치하는 것은 더 이상 지원되지 않습니다. Microsoft SQL Server을 설치할 때 사용할 수 있는 유일한 데이터베이스 유형은 Control Room입니다.
  • 온프레미스 설치의 경우 Linux 외부 키 저장소가 지원되지 않습니다.

전제 조건

다음 사항을 확인하십시오.

  • Microsoft SQL Server 데이터베이스가 설치되고 실행 중입니다.
  • Automation 360 설치 서버가 Microsoft SQL Server 데이터베이스에 연결되어 있습니다..
  • Automation 360 빌드 6463에서 Python 3.6이 설치되어 있는지 확인합니다.

프로시저

  1. 설치 선행조건을 확인합니다.
    1. Automation 360 온프레미스 선행조건을 확인합니다.
    2. Microsoft SQL Server가 실행 중인지확인하고 다음 명령을 실행합니다.

      $ sudo systemctl status mssql-server

      Microsoft SQL Server가 실행되고 있지 않으면 설치합니다.

      Microsoft SQL Server 설치 지침은 Red Hat Enterprise Linux 버전 8을 참조하십시오. 자세한 정보는 Quickstart: Install SQL Server의 내용을 참조하십시오.

      버전 7의 경우 /rhel/8 대신 /rhel/7로 경로를 변경합니다.

    3. 다음 파일을 사용할 수 있는지 확인합니다.
      • SSL 인증서
      • 라이선스 파일
    4. A-People Downloads page (Login required)에서 Linux 서버로 Automation360_el7_Build_<build_number>.bin 설치 파일을 다운로드합니다.
      주: 당사는 Linux에서 패치 릴리스로의 업데이트(동일한 Automation 360 릴리스의 빌드 간 업데이트)를 지원하지 않습니다. 그러나 최신 패치 릴리스로 업데이트하려면 Automation 360을 삭제하고 패치 릴리스를 새로 설치하는 것이 좋습니다.
    5. Yum 업데이트를 사용하여 Linux 커널 파일 및 OS 라이브러리를 업데이트하려면 설치 서버에 인터넷 액세스 권한이 있는지 확인합니다.
      아니면, 네트워크에 Yum 로컬 리포지토리를 사용하여 설치 서버에서 /etc/yum.conf를 구성합니다. Yum 리포지토리는 설치를 시작하기 전에 최신 상태여야 합니다.
  2. 설치 서버에 로그인합니다.
  3. Linux 쉘에서 슈퍼 사용자로 설치 프로그램 명령을 실행합니다.
    1. $ sudo chmod +x Automation360_el7_Build_<build_number>.bin
    2. $ sudo ./Automation360_el7_Build_<build_number>.bin
    설치 마법사는 설치 요구 사항을 확인하고 설치를 진행합니다.
    팁:
    • back 명령을 입력하여 이전 명령 단계로 돌아갑니다.
    • 리턴 키를 눌러 기본값을 적용하거나, 다른 값을 입력한 다음 리턴 키를 누릅니다.
  4. 라이선스 계약에 동의하려면 Y를 입력합니다.
  5. TLS(Transport Layer Security) 화면에서 다음을 구성합니다.
    1. Control Room HTTP 포트(기본값: 80)
    2. Control Room HTTPS 포트(기본값: 443)
    3. 자체 서명 인증서를 활성화하려면 1을 입력하여 활성화하거나 2를 입력하여 비활성화합니다.
      이 옵션을 비활성화하면 사용자 정의 인증서를 설치할 수 있습니다.
      1. 인증서 경로를 입력합니다.
      2. 인증서 암호를 입력합니다.
      3. 중간 인증서 사용: 활성화하려면 1을 입력하고, 비활성화하려면 2를 입력합니다.

        이 옵션을 활성화하면 Enter path to Intermediate Certificates .zip File 옵션에 중간 인증서 경로를 입력하여 중간 인증서를 설치합니다.

    4. HTTP 트래픽을 HTTPS로 강제하려면 1을 입력하여 비활성화하거나 2를 입력하여 활성화합니다.
  6. 클러스터 구성 화면에서 1을 입력하여 비활성화하거나, 2를 입력하여 활성화합니다.
    • 클러스터 구성을 활성화한 경우, 클러스터 노드의 IP 주소를 입력합니다. IP 주소를 2개 이상 지정하려면 쉼표(,)를 사용합니다. IP 주소 사이에 공백을 추가하지 마십시오. 예시: 192.168.0.1,192.168.0.2,192.168.0.3
    • 리포지토리 위치는 클러스터의 모든 Control Room 노드에서 액세스할 수 있는 공유 위치여야 합니다.
    • Control Room의 다른 노드와 통신하는 데 사용되는 IP 주소를 선택했는지 확인하십시오.
  7. 데이터베이스 유형 화면에서 Microsoft SQL Server 서버를 선택합니다.
  8. 서비스 시작 옵션 화면에서 다음 옵션 중 하나를 선택합니다.
    • 기본값(모든 서비스 시작): 모든 Control Room 서비스를 활성화하여 시작 시 자동으로 실행합니다.
    • 사용자 정의(시작 옵션 선택): 시작 시 자동으로 실행하려는 Control Room 서비스를 선택할 수 있습니다. 모든 서비스가 기기에 설치됩니다. 그러나 선택한 서비스만 시작할 때 자동으로 실행됩니다. 필요한 경우 수동으로 설정된 서비스를 수동으로 시작할 수 있습니다.

      각 서비스에 대해 다음 옵션 중 하나를 선택합니다.

      • 자동: 시작 시 선택한 서비스를 자동으로 실행합니다.
      • 수동: 필요한 경우 선택한 서비스를 수동으로 활성화할 수 있습니다.
    주:
    • 선택한 데이터베이스 유형에 따라 일부 서비스는 선택한 데이터베이스 유형에 대해 아직 지원되지 않을 수 있으므로 일부 서비스를 선택하지 못할 수 있습니다.
    • Automation 360 온프레미스 Control Room을 설치할 때 시작 시 실행하도록 포함하지 않은 서비스의 경우, 텍스트 편집기를 사용하여 열 수 있는 config 파일 디렉토리에 products.notinstalled 파일이 생성됩니다. 이 파일에는 Automation 360 온프레미스 Control Room 설치 시 선택하지 않은 서비스의 이름이 포함되어 있습니다. 디렉터리 구조에 대한 자세한 내용은 설치된 Control Room 디렉토리 및 파일 항목을 참조하십시오.
  9. 서버에 대한 다음 설정을 구성합니다.
    Microsoft 데이터베이스 구성
    데이터베이스 서버 주소(기본값: localhost)
    데이터베이스 포트(기본값: 1433)
    Control Room 데이터베이스(기본값: Automation360-Database) 또는 이름을 입력합니다.
    SQL Server 로그인 자격증명: 로그인 ID와 SQL 서버 비밀번호를 입력합니다.
    Elasticsearch에 대한 비밀번호 프롬프트: 비밀번호를 입력하거나 정의합니다.
  10. 데이터베이스 구성 화면에서 다음을 구성합니다.
    1. 데이터베이스 서버 주소(기본값: localhost)
    2. 데이터베이스 포트(기본값: 1433)
    3. Control Room 데이터베이스(기본값: Automation360-Database) 또는 이름을 입력합니다.
    4. SQL Server 로그인 자격증명: 로그인 ID와 SQL 서버 비밀번호를 입력합니다.
    5. Elasticsearch에 대한 비밀번호 프롬프트: 비밀번호를 입력하거나 정의합니다.
  11. 설치 전 요약을 검토합니다.
  12. Enter 키를 눌러 Automation 360를 기본 디렉터리에 설치합니다.
    Linux 설치 프로그램 버전 기본 디렉터리 경로
    설치 파일 경로 v.22 이전 /opt/automationanywhere/enterprise
    이전 버전에서 v.22로 업데이트
    v.22 이상의 신규 설치 /opt/automationanywhere/automation360
    설치가 성공적으로 완료되었다는 메시지가 나타납니다. Control Room 애셋의 위치는 설치된 Control Room 디렉토리 및 파일의 내용을 참조하십시오.
  13. 설치 후 설정을 구성합니다.
    설치 후 Control Room 그룹 controlroom이 자동으로 생성됩니다. 다음 사용자는 해당 Control Room 서비스를 실행하는 이 그룹의 일부입니다. crkernel, traefik, ignite, activemq, crelasticsearch, criqbot, crbotinsight, craari, crdiscoverybot, crstorage, crdiscoverybotml
  14. Automation 360 서비스가 성공적으로 시작되었는지 확인합니다.
  15. Control Room 액세스를 설정합니다.
  16. 라이선스를 설정합니다.
    추가 라이선스 설치 항목을 참조하십시오.
  17. Control Room 설치 파일 로그는 지정된 다음 위치에서 제공됩니다.
    Linux 설치 프로그램 버전 로그 파일 경로
    로그 경로 v.22 및 이전 버전 /var/log/automationanywhere/enterprise
    이전 버전에서 v.22로 업데이트
    v.22 이상의 신규 설치 /var/log/automationanywhere/automation360

다음 단계

Control Room 설치 및 구성을 완료한 후 사용자는 기기를 등록하여 Bot을 생성하고 실행할 수 있습니다. Bot 에이전트 설치 및 기기 등록 항목을 참조하십시오.

OOM(메모리 부족 관리) killer에 대한 자세한 내용은 Linux Automation 360 Control Room service stopped (A-People login required) 항목을 참조하십시오.